When synthetic or non-gum emulsifiers are employed, the proportions given in the preceding procedures turn out to be meaningless. Essentially the most proper approach for planning emulsions from surfactants or other non-gum emulsifiers is to begin by dividing factors into drinking water soluble and oil soluble factors. All oil soluble elements are dissolved from the oily phase get more info in a single beaker and all drinking water soluble factors are dissolved in the drinking water within a independent beaker.

An emulsion is really a dispersion of 1 liquid into a next immiscible liquid. There are 2 forms: oil-in-water (o/w) emulsions the place oil is The inner stage and drinking water is constant, and h2o-in-oil (w/o) emulsions in which water is The inner period and oil is continuous. Emulsions demand an emulsifying agent to help you disperse just one liquid into compact globules within the other liquid and sustain steadiness.

Pharmaceutical emulsions are dispersions of 1 liquid in Yet another immiscible liquid. An emulsion consists of at least two liquid phases, a single dispersed as globules in one other, and stabilized by an emulsifying agent. Emulsions may be oil-in-water or water-in-oil based on which period is dispersed. Emulsions are thermodynamically unstable and count on emulsifying agents to kinetically stabilize the method by cutting down interfacial tension or forming protecting movies all over globules.
